The Hidden Dangers of Neglected Gutters

  • Water Damage to Foundations: Overflowing gutters can saturate the soil around your home's foundation, leading to cracks, structural instability, and expensive repairs.
  • Roof and Fascia Damage: Constant moisture from overflowing gutters can rot fascia boards, damage roof eaves, and even compromise the integrity of your roof gutter system, leading to costly roof repairs or even a full roof replacement.
  • Pest Infestations: Stagnant water in clogged or damaged gutters creates a perfect breeding ground for mosquitoes and other pests.
  • Landscape Erosion: Uncontrolled water runoff can erode garden beds, damage plants, and create muddy pathways around your home.
  • Mould and Mildew: Excess moisture against your home’s exterior can promote the growth of mould and mildew, impacting air quality and requiring extensive cleaning.

When is it Time for Gutter Replacement? Key Signs to Look For

Knowing when to call for gutter replacement services can save you a lot of headache and money. Here are the tell-tale signs that your gutters are past their prime:

  • Persistent Leaks: If you see water dripping from seams or holes, it's a clear sign of trouble. While some leaks can be patched (gutter repair), widespread issues often mean replacement is required.
  • Rust and Corrosion: Especially common in older galvanised steel gutters, rust can weaken the metal and create holes. If rust is extensive, replacement perth or in any other city is usually the only long-term solution.
  • Sagging or Pulling Away from the House: This indicates that the gutters are either filled with debris, holding too much water, or the fasteners are failing. Such issues can lead to structural damage to your fascia.
  • Cracks and Splits: Small cracks can be repaired, but larger ones, especially those that recur, signal that the material is deteriorating.
  • Peeling Paint or Water Stains: On your home's exterior walls or fascia boards, these are classic indicators of overflowing or leaking gutters. This water damage can lead to bigger problems if not addressed.
  • Missing Sections: Storms or wear and tear can cause sections of your gutters or downpipes to go missing, leaving your home vulnerable.
  • Frequent Clogging: If your gutters are constantly getting blocked even after thorough gutter cleaning, it might be due to incorrect pitch or internal damage, making replacement a more efficient solution.

If you're noticing any of these issues, it's time to consider a professional roof inspection and a discussion about gutter replacement. Don't wait until minor problems escalate into major ones.

Factors Influencing Gutter Replacement Costs

  1. Material Choice: This is often the biggest cost driver. Options range from economical PVC to durable Colorbond and premium copper. We'll explore these in detail shortly.
  2. Length of Gutters: Naturally, a larger home requires more materials and labour. Get a precise measurement during your roof inspection.
  3. Complexity of Installation: Homes with multiple rooflines, tight corners, or difficult access points will incur higher labour costs.
  4. Number and Type of Downpipes: Replacing or adding new downpipes will add to the overall expense.
  5. Removal of Old Gutters: This usually includes disposal fees.
  6. Location: Costs can vary between major cities like Sydney, Melbourne, Perth, Brisbane, Adelaide, and Hobart due to differing labour rates and material availability. For instance, gutter replacement Perth might have slightly different average costs than gutter replacement Sydney.
  7. Additional Services: Do you need gutter guard installation, minor roof repairs, or fascia replacement at the same time? Bundling services can sometimes be more cost-effective.

Typical Price Ranges for Gutter Replacement in Australia

Based on industry averages and snippets from top service providers, a complete gutter replacement for a standard Australian home can range from approximately $1,500 to $4,000. This is a general guide, and larger or more complex projects, or those using premium materials, can exceed this range. Choosing the Right Gutter Materials for Australian Conditions

Inserted image

The material you choose for your new gutters will impact their longevity, appearance, and cost. Here’s a look at the most common options available for gutter replacement in Australia:

Material Type Pros Cons Typical Cost (Relative)
Colorbond Steel
  • Extremely durable and long-lasting
  • Wide range of colours to match your home
  • Resistant to chipping, peeling, and cracking
  • Excellent corrosion resistance for Australian weather
  • Higher initial cost than PVC
  • Can dent if hit by heavy objects
Mid-High
Zincalume/Galvanised Steel
  • Strong and robust
  • Good value for money
  • Traditional look
  • Less colour variety than Colorbond
  • Can eventually rust, especially at cut edges
Mid
Aluminium
  • Lightweight and easy to install
  • Rust-resistant, ideal for coastal areas (e.g., Perth WA)
  • Available in various colours
  • Can dent more easily than steel
  • May expand and contract more with temperature changes
Mid
PVC/Plastic
  • Most affordable option
  • Lightweight and easy DIY installation
  • Rust-proof
  • Less durable than metal options
  • Can become brittle over time due to UV exposure
  • Limited colour choices
Low

The Gutter Replacement Process: What to Expect

Understanding the steps involved in gutter replacement can help you feel more confident and prepared. A professional gutter repair expert or team will follow a structured process to ensure quality workmanship.

1. Initial Roof Inspection & Assessment

A qualified professional will conduct a thorough roof inspection to assess the condition of your existing gutters, downpipes, fascia, and surrounding roof areas. They’ll identify any underlying issues, such as timber rot or signs of water damage, that need to be addressed before new gutters are installed. This crucial step ensures a comprehensive solution.

2. Professional Quote & Material Selection

Based on the assessment, you'll receive a detailed quote outlining the scope of work, recommended materials (e.g., Colorbond gutters), labour costs, and a timeline. 3. Removal of Old Gutters & Downpipes

The existing gutters and downpipes will be carefully removed and properly disposed of. This is often the messiest part of the process, but professional teams ensure the site is kept clean and tidy.

4. New Gutter Installation & Downpipe Connection

The new gutters are precisely cut, fitted, and securely attached to your fascia boards, ensuring the correct pitch for optimal water flow. New downpipes are then installed and connected, directing water away from your home's foundation. This phase requires skilled roof plumbing to ensure effective drainage and prevent future gutter leaks.

5. Post-Installation Check & Maintenance Tips

Once installation is complete, the team will perform a final inspection to ensure everything is correctly installed and functioning. They may even test the system with water. They’ll also provide essential advice on maintaining your new gutters, including recommendations for regular gutter cleaning and potentially installing a gutter guard or leaf guard to minimise debris buildup.

Gutter Repair vs. Replacement: Making the Right Call

Sometimes, a full gutter replacement isn't immediately necessary. Minor issues like a small hole, a loose joint, or a sagging section might be fixed with a targeted gutter repair. However, if the damage is extensive, widespread, or recurring, the cost-effectiveness and longevity of a full replacement service often outweigh repeated repairs. A qualified gutter repair expert can advise you on the most economical and durable solution after a thorough roof inspection.

The Importance of Gutter Cleaning & Maintenance

Even new gutters require regular maintenance. Debris like leaves, twigs, and dirt can accumulate, leading to blockages and overflowing. Regular clean gutters prevent these problems and extend the life of your system. Consider professional gutter cleaning services at least twice a year, especially after autumn or major storms.

Protecting Your Investment with Gutter Guards

To further reduce maintenance and prevent blockages, consider installing a gutter guard or leaf guard. These systems cover your gutters, allowing water to flow through while keeping debris out. This is a particularly smart investment for homes surrounded by trees, significantly reducing the frequency of clean gutters being required.
